Introduction to Alumina Textile Ceramic Eyelets

Ceramic components have become integral in various industrial applications due to their exceptional properties. Among these, alumina textile ceramic eyelets stand out for their durability and performance in textile manufacturing. These eyelets are crafted from aluminum oxide, commonly known as alumina, which is a ceramic material with excellent wear resistance and mechanical strength.

Characteristics of Alumina Ceramics

Alumina ceramics are known for their hardness and ability to withstand high temperatures, making them suitable for use in environments where other materials may fail. The alumina ceramic used in eyelets is typically of a high purity grade, ensuring minimal wear and tear on textile fibers as they pass through. This attribute is crucial in maintaining the integrity of the fibers during high-speed textile processing.

Applications in Textile Industry

The primary application of ceramic eyelets is to guide yarn and fibers in textile machinery. Their smooth surface minimizes friction, which is essential for preventing damage to delicate threads. Additionally, the thermal stability of alumina ceramic eyelets ensures they perform consistently across a range of temperatures, a common requirement in textile production processes.

Advantages of Using Alumina Eyelets

The use of alumina textile ceramic eyelets offers several advantages over traditional materials. Their resistance to corrosion and wear extends the life of the eyelets, reducing the need for frequent replacements. Furthermore, their non-conductive nature makes them safe for use in electrical environments, which is often a consideration in automated textile machinery.

Types and Customization

Textile ceramic components come in various shapes and sizes, tailored to different functions within textile equipment. While standard dimensions are widely available, customization options are also offered by manufacturers to meet specific industrial requirements. This flexibility ensures that machinery can be fitted with eyelets that provide optimal performance for the intended application.

Selection Considerations

When selecting alumina ceramic components for textile machinery, it is important to consider the specific needs of the application, including the type of fiber being processed and the machinery's operational speed. The right choice of eyelet can significantly impact the efficiency and quality of the textile production process.
